Which among the following salts forms basic solution when dissolved in water?
Options
- ANH ₄ NO ₃
- BNa ₂ CO ₃
- CNaNO ₃
- DCuSO ₄
Correct answer
B. Na ₂ CO ₃
Step-by-step solution
Determining salt hydrolysis behavior requires analyzing the acid-base character of constituent ions. Ammonium nitrate ( NH ₄ NO ₃ ) derives from weak base NH ₄ OH and strong acid HNO ₃ . Its cation hydrolyzes: NH ₄^+ + H ₂ O NH ₄ OH + H ^+ , yielding acidic solution. Sodium carbonate ( Na ₂ CO ₃ ) comes from strong base NaOH and weak acid H ₂ CO ₃ .
